Output 3ab5c40f4e2b8a56ea79df9be3ffc16a094b4f29ce6491f81796efe8bca32987:0

value
684250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73520e063acc650a4ac496bcd4d97b3dda18b6f5 OP_EQUALVERIFY OP_CHECKSIG
address
1BWm1Kx9wp5PaeAJr4x9KPTBYt2cJL9uSr
transaction
3ab5c40f4e2b8a56ea79df9be3ffc16a094b4f29ce6491f81796efe8bca32987
spent
true